Closing a Fan of Cards

Taught by Disturb Reality on YouTube — watch it there to support the creator.

Imagine the moment when a fan of cards gracefully closes with just one hand, leaving your audience in awe. This flourish adds a touch of magic to your performance.

Why learn it

Learning to close a fan of cards elevates your card handling skills and adds flair to your tricks. It's perfect for impressing friends or enhancing a magic routine.

What you need

All you need are a standard deck of playing cards and a little practice space. This trick can be done anywhere!

Playing Cards

How hard is it?

This trick is intermediate level, helping you build dexterity and control with one hand. It's a rewarding challenge that will impress your audience.
